java编写程序,用switch语句实现如下功能:用户输入月份,输出相应的季度。
时间: 2024-10-15 19:18:28 浏览: 41
java代码-给定默认成绩,然后利用switch语句选择成绩的优异程度
在Java中,你可以使用`switch`语句结合变量的整数值来实现这个功能。假设用户输入的是月份(1-12分别代表1月到12月),你可以创建一个函数来处理这个逻辑。这里是一个简单的示例:
```java
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.println("请输入月份(1-12):");
int month = scanner.nextInt();
// 使用switch语句根据月份判断季度
switch (month) {
case 1:
case 2:
case 3:
System.out.println("第一季度");
break;
case 4:
case 5:
case 6:
System.out.println("第二季度");
break;
case 7:
case 8:
case 9:
System.out.println("第三季度");
break;
case 10:
case 11:
case 12:
System.out.println("第四季度");
break;
default:
System.out.println("输入错误,月份应为1-12");
}
scanner.close();
}
}
```
在这个例子中,我们检查输入的月份并根据每个可能的范围打印出对应的季度。如果输入的月份不在1-12之间,我们会显示一个错误消息。
阅读全文